Subject: Re: [RFC PATCH] SUNRPC: Fix UAF in svc_tcp_listen_data_ready()
Date: Sun, 7 May 2023 15:26:49 +0000	[thread overview]
Message-ID: <EED05302-8BC6-4593-B798-BFC476FA190E@oracle.com> (raw)
In-Reply-To: <20230507091131.23540-1-dinghui@sangfor.com.cn>



> On May 7, 2023, at 5:11 AM, Ding Hui <dinghui@sangfor.com.cn> wrote:
> 
> After the listener svc_sock freed, and before invoking svc_tcp_accept()
> for the established child sock, there is a window that the newsock
> retaining a freed listener svc_sock in sk_user_data which cloning from
> parent. In the race windows if data is received on the newsock, we will
> observe use-after-free report in svc_tcp_listen_data_ready().

My thought is that not calling sk_odata() for the newsock
could potentially result in missing a data_ready event,
resulting in a hung client on that socket.

IMO the preferred approach is to ensure that svsk is always
safe to dereference in tcp_listen_data_ready. I haven't yet
thought carefully about how to do that.

> In this RFC patch, I try to fix the UAF by skipping dereferencing
> svsk for all child socket in svc_tcp_listen_data_ready(), it is
> easy to backport for stable.
> 
> However I'm not sure if there are other potential risks in the race
> window, so I thought another fix which depends on SK_USER_DATA_NOCOPY
> introduced in commit f1ff5ce2cd5e ("net, sk_msg: Clear sk_user_data
> pointer on clone if tagged").
> 
> Saving svsk into sk_user_data with SK_USER_DATA_NOCOPY tag in
> svc_setup_socket() like this:
> 
>  __rcu_assign_sk_user_data_with_flags(inet, svsk, SK_USER_DATA_NOCOPY);
> 
> Obtaining svsk in callbacks like this:
> 
>  struct svc_sock *svsk = rcu_dereference_sk_user_data(sk);
> 
> This will avoid copying sk_user_data for sunrpc svc_sock in
> sk_clone_lock(), so the sk_user_data of child sock before accepted
> will be NULL.
> 
> Appreciate any comment and suggestion, thanks.
